Exports In 2018, Oman exported $49.5k in Fishing Ships, making it the 65th largest exporter of Fishing Ships in the world. At the same year, Fishing Ships was the 738th most exported product in Oman. The main destination of Fishing Ships exports from Oman are: Yemen ($39k) and Tanzania ($10.5k).

Imports In 2022, Oman imported $3.62M in Fishing Ships, becoming the 34th largest importer of Fishing Ships in the world. At the same year, Fishing Ships was the 570th most imported product in Oman. Oman imports Fishing Ships primarily from: United Arab Emirates ($2.71M), Spain ($528k), India ($238k), Bahrain ($63.9k), and Tunisia ($50.7k).

The fastest growing import markets in Fishing Ships for Oman between 2021 and 2022 were United Arab Emirates ($1.99M), Spain ($528k), and India ($238k).
